Location That Works

Karsana sits within Abuja’s expanding residential belt, positioned to benefit from the city’s steady outward growth pattern. As central districts fill up and prices there climb further out of reach for many buyers, areas like Karsana absorb that demand — offering a genuine alternative that’s still well-connected to the rest of the city.

Growth Without the Premium (Yet)

Established districts in Abuja often carry a price premium that reflects years of prior development. Karsana, by contrast, offers access to a genuinely growing area without that fully priced-in premium — which is precisely the window smart investors look for. Buying into an area as it develops, rather than after it has already matured, is where the strongest long-term returns tend to come from.
